Prokaryotic
Refers to organisms whose cells lack a defined nucleus and membrane-bound organelles, characteristic of bacteria and archaea.
Eukaryotic
Pertaining to cells that contain a nucleus enclosed within membranes, distinguishing them from prokaryotic cells, which do not.
DNA
A molecule known as Deoxyribonucleic acid, DNA serves as the carrier of genetic guidelines necessary for the life processes, including growth, development, operation, and reproduction, in every known living entity and several viruses.
RNA
RNA, or ribonucleic acid, is a nucleic acid involved in coding, decoding, regulation, and expression of genes, playing a key role in protein synthesis and regulation.
